Get to know the school

How it's doing. In 2024/25, 73.0% of pupils reached the expected standard in reading, writing, and maths, compared to the national median of 64%. Only 6.0% reached the higher standard. Ofsted rated the school Good in May 2023. Its position is much the same whether compared with all schools or only those whose pupils have similar backgrounds (6.1 out of 10 against similar schools, 6.2 out of 10 against all schools).

Beyond the classroom. The school provides both a breakfast club and an after-school club for wraparound care.

Getting in. There are 401 pupils in a school with 420 places, leaving 19 spare places. The school is close to full, so places are likely to be competitive.
